WebThe majority of thumb and phalangeal dislocations are dorsal, and the finger or thumb will appear hyper-extended at the affected joint. Puckering of skin around the joint suggests that soft tissue may be interposed within the joint. A dorsal dislocation of the PIP joint can tear the volar plate or cause an avulsion fracture of the middle phalanx. WebBuddy taping (taping the damaged finger to the finger next to it or between two fingers) is an acceptable alternative. When the joint dislocates but only near the end of full extension, then a figure-of-eight splint can be used. X-rays must show that the joint stays in place while the finger is in the splint.
